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我想知道 PGP 中数据加密和解密的工作原理。作为加密的一部分,“gpg --gen-key”用于生成密钥,我得到了一个公钥,但我不知道如何获得私钥。它是否存储在特定位置?有什么命令可以生成吗?我没有任何线索。
这在我所关注的文档中没有指定。
私钥不像公钥那样“可见”,但您可以按照以下说明获取它:
您可以通过这种方式列出私钥,以检查它是否存在:
gpg --list-secret-keys
并且您可以在备份密钥时使其可见:
gpg --armor --export-secret-keys your_email@domain.com > your_name.asc